#d653a2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d653a2 is composed of 83.9% red, 32.5%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.2% magenta, 24.3%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 323.8 degrees, a saturation of 61.5% and a lightness of 58.2%. #d653a2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a6ff with #ad0045.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#d653a2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d653a2 has RGB values of R:214, G:83, B:162 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.61, Y:0.24,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14046114.
